WAN Optimization Controller Provider Astrocom, Changes Name to Ecessa


PLYMOUTH, Minn. --(Business Wire)-- Astrocom, a leader in affordable WAN Optimization Controllers specializing in WAN and ISP link aggregation, load balancing, failover, and network security for small-to-medium sized enterprises (SME), today announced that it has changed its name to Ecessa. Along with the new company name, Ecessa appointed Marc Goodman as its new marketing director to lead all corporate and product marketing efforts.



Ecessa comes from the word Necessary, which incorporates the key concept of the necessary technology for reliable and fast WAN infrastructure vital for business continuity. Ecessa offers a family of proven products that provide small and medium-sized enterprises and service providers the solutions they need to reliably and securely manage and control vital network connectivity.

About Ecessa Ecessa (formerly Astrocom) is a leader in affordable WAN Optimization Controllers for WAN and ISP link aggregation, automated load balancing, failover and network security tailored to meet the needs of small-to-medium sized enterprises (SME) that rely on the Internet for e-commerce and business-critical application delivery. Ecessa helps SMEs rapidly grow their business with 24/7 network high-availability, optimized WAN performance, flexible scalability and secure access - while streamlining IT costs.

At one-third the cost of other competing products, Ecessa's PowerLink offering delivers industry leading price/performance value. Ecessa optimizes WAN traffic for organizations of all types who wish to improve network and application performance and eliminate downtime for business-critical, time-sensitive applications.

Ecessa uses multi-homing to connect a single LAN to multiple ISPs; enables quality-of-service to prioritize network traffic that ensures the best possible bandwidth is always available to applications, especially during periods of congestion; and uses link load balancing and automatic failover to direct traffic to WAN links with the optimum bandwidth and cost-efficiencies.

Over 6,000 companies rely on Ecessa to cost-effectively ensure that each application has the appropriate Internet bandwidth and availability needed to support user and business requirements.
